Wightwick Manor, a beautiful area located in Staffordshire, England, is renowned for its stunning Victorian architecture and picturesque surroundings. This charming suburb combines historical elegance with modern living, offering a serene environment away from the bustling city of Wolverhampton while still being conveniently close to urban amenities.     Wightwick



    Wightwick

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    Wightwick is known for its beautiful Victorian homes and affluent ambiance. The area is characterized by its lush greenery and historical significance, providing residents with a peaceful and upscale living environment.



    Characteristics of the Wightwick

    * Culture: Rich Victorian history, nearby art galleries, and local events

    * Transportation: Well-connected by bus routes to Wolverhampton and surrounding areas

    * Services: Local shops, fine dining restaurants, and parks

    * Environment: Peaceful and family-friendly with a sense of community


    Housing Options in the Wightwick

    Victorian villas, Detached homes, Apartments


    Average Home Prices in the Wightwick

    * Buying: £350,000 – £600,000

    * Renting: £1,200 – £2,000/month

    Tettenhall



    Tettenhall

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    Located nearby, Tettenhall is known for its excellent schools and family-friendly environment, making it an ideal choice for families seeking a vibrant community.



    Characteristics of the Tettenhall

    * Culture: Educational events, parks, and historical walks

    * Transportation: Excellent bus services and proximity to main roads

    * Services: Schools, shopping streets, and sports facilities

    * Environment: Lively and family-oriented with plenty of activities


    Housing Options in the Tettenhall

    Townhouses, Family homes


    Average Home Prices in the Tettenhall

    * Buying: £300,000 – £500,000

    * Renting: £1,000 – £1,800/month
